Output 1003d21629384050ba5cde4d15074a71620b47e7bd8636e900869ebc467fb196:8

value
972478
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 484f6f7c9a6793711d74c1b46dc869e419e2e537 OP_EQUALVERIFY OP_CHECKSIG
address
17bLp62p2ffD95tRMYRhgxcewXgC8BJAZV
transaction
1003d21629384050ba5cde4d15074a71620b47e7bd8636e900869ebc467fb196
spent
true